P(x)=x^4−3x^2+kx−2 where k is an unknown integer
P(x) divided by (x−2) has a remainder of 10.
What is the value of k?

Answer:

k = 4

Step-by-step explanation:

p(2) = (2)^4- 3(2)^2 +k(2) -2 = 10

16 - 12 - 2 + 2k = 10

2 +2k = 10

2k = 10 - 2 = 8

k = 4
